AP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

在app上开发h5是什么意思

在APP上开发H5,是指利用HTML5、CSS和JavaScript等Web技术开发适用于移动端的网页应用程序。H5即HTML5,是一个新版本的超文本标记语言,是Web标准的重要组成部分,是Web应用实现互联的核心技术之一。

H5可以在移动APP内嵌入的WebView控件中展示,并具有很好的加载速度、跨平台、可扩展性等优点,因此越来越受到企业和开发者的青睐。下面简要介绍在APP上开发H5的原理及相关技术。

1. 原理

在APP上开发H5的原理其实就是将一个Web页面运行在移动设备APP中,可以通过WebView控件将其嵌入到APP内展示,并且可以使用原生APP提供的API和功能,比如手机的通讯录、相机、地理位置等。

2. 技术

在APP上开发H5需要掌握以下技术:

2.1 HTML5、CSS和JavaScript

HTML5是实现Web页面的核心语言,CSS用于页面样式设计,JavaScript则可以实现页面交互及逻辑控制等功能,因此熟练掌握这些技术是开发H5的基础。

2.2 移动端Web开发框架

移动端Web开发框架可以快速搭建Web应用程序,使开发更高效、更规范化。常见的移动框架有jQuery Mobile、Bootstrap、Framework7等,选择一个合适的移动框架对开发非常重要。

2.3 移动端Web调试工具

移动端Web调试工具可以帮助开发者在移动设备上调试Web页面,效果可以比较真实的反映出实际运行中的情况,常见的调试工具有Chrome DevTools、Weinre、Eruda等。

2.4 APP和H5数据交互

在APP和H5中实现数据交互能够提高APP的用户体验和交互性。移动端APP和H5之间的数据交互主要通过Ajax技术来实现,可以通过GET、POST方式发送JSON数据来请求和传递数据。

2.5 APP和H5的跨域问题

在APP中使用H5时,跨域请求是一个常见的问题,因为APP中的WebView和H5页面在技术上是两个不同域的资源,为了解决这个问题,可以通过配置WebView的跨域策略、JSONP、iframe跨域等方式进行处理。

以上是在APP上开发H5的原理及相关技术的简单介绍,相信对于有一定Web开发基础的读者来说可以更好地了解和掌握这方面的技术。


相关知识:
制作h5邀请函app
制作H5邀请函APP,要注意以下几个步骤:1. 需求分析首先,我们需要明确自己的需求,例如app的功能需求、用户体验需求、设计需求等等。需要考虑清楚这些因素,并将它们记录下来。2. 技术选型根据需求分析,选择适合自己的技术方案,例如选择哪种框架、编程语言等
2023-05-26
h5与app混合开发遇到的问题总结
H5与APP混合开发是指将网页应用(H5)嵌入到APP中,通过JS与Native代码交互,实现更加丰富的交互和体验。在这个过程中,开发者会遇到不少问题,下面对一些常见问题做一个总结。1. 页面性能问题在开发混合应用时,由于H5页面和Native页面的渲染机
2023-05-25
h5网址封装app
在移动互联网时代,很多网站都推出了自己的APP,而对于一些小型的网站或者新兴的网站来说,尚未有开发APP的经费和技术,但是又希望能够进入移动互联网领域能够为用户提供更好的体验,此时H5网址封装App就是一个很好的选择。H5网址封装App是指将网站H5页面通
2023-05-25
h5手游app制作
随着移动互联网技术的不断发展,手游市场成为了移动互联网领域中的重要组成部分。而h5手游app制作,成为了越来越多开发者的选择。属于Web开发领域,它和原生开发相比有更好的跨平台特性,可以在具有浏览器功能的设备上运行,是一种适合广泛推广的制作方式。下面我们来
2023-05-25
h5开发app入门
H5开发APP,也称为Web App,是一种基于Web技术,通过跨平台技术实现APP应用的开发形式。H5开发APP的入门需要了解以下的原理和技术。一、H5开发APP的优点1.跨平台性好:H5开发的APP可以在不同的平台上运行,只需要在浏览器中打开即可,无需
2023-05-25
h5技术能开发什么app
H5(HTML5)技术已经成为了当今移动应用开发的主要技术之一。由于H5技术基于Web技术,所以能够在多个平台上使用。而且H5技术相比于原生的移动应用,需要下载和安装以后才能使用,H5可以直接在浏览器上使用,无需下载和安装。本文将会介绍H5技术能开发哪些A
2023-05-25
h5即时通讯app开发源码
H5即时通讯APP的开发源码可以通过多种方式实现,其中最受欢迎的方式是使用WebRTC技术。WebRTC是一种开放式标准,可直接在Web浏览器中实现实时通信。本文将介绍如何使用JavaScript和WebRTC创建H5即时通讯应用程序。一、WebRTC技术
2023-05-25
h5封装app后期维护
H5封装App是指通过把H5页面包装为本地应用程序的形式,在移动设备上运行H5页面。H5页面可以通过Cordova、PhoneGap等工具来进行封装,而移动设备可以是iOS或Android平台。相比于原生开发,使用H5封装App可以大幅降低开发成本,提高开
2023-05-25
h5打包app有哪些
随着移动互联网时代的不断发展,越来越多的企业和个人开始关注将自己的网站或应用打包成APP,以扩大自己的用户群,提高用户体验。而HTML5技术的出现,使得使用网页技术构建应用变得更加容易和高效。在此基础上,我们可以采用不同的方式将H5应用封装成APP,并在各
2023-05-25
h5打包app图片不显示
H5是一种基于HTML5技术的Web开发模式,能够在移动设备上实现跨平台的Web应用。而将H5应用打包成一款 APP,则需要使用一些工具,例如PhoneGap(Cordova)或使用React Native来实现。不过,在将H5应用打包成APP的过程中,可
2023-05-25
app混合开发h5写什么页面
APP混合开发是指在移动应用中,通过WebView控件将网页或H5页面嵌入到应用中,实现APP与网页的交互。混合开发优点是可以快速构建跨平台APP,并且可以充分利用Web开发的技术栈和生态。在APP混合开发中,H5页面扮演着非常重要的角色。它是移动应用与互
2023-05-25
app混合开发内嵌的h5网页
随着移动互联网的不断发展,市场上越来越多的App开始涌现出来。为了提高用户体验,App开发者需要在App中加入Web页面,来展示更多的内容和更好的交互方式。而混合开发正是一个解决方案。混合开发是将原生App与Web技术结合起来的一种开发方式。在这种开发方式
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3